On the Lüneburg-Neetze road there is an extensive area with numerous archaeological monuments and monuments. The necropolis includes two megalithic tombs, numerous burial mounds, urn cemeteries and a hump burial ground. The group shows in an impressive way the close spatial juxtaposition of very different types of burial from different epochs. The burials range from the Neolithic to the Bronze Age and pre-Roman Iron Age to the Roman Empire and Migration Period. Source: https://denkmalatlas.niedersachsen.de/viewer/metadata/28932106/1/-/

Rullstorf. A summer day in 1967, between Scharnebeck and Rullstorf. Christian Krohn is on the way to his uncle in Rullstorf, as always he walks over the Kronsberg, past fields and the large sand pit. A fresh edge makes the 24-year-old curious, he stops, looks at the sand wall and discovers parts of a ceramic vessel on the upper edge that protrudes from the earth. Krohn digs it up and holds an urn that is more than 3000 years old in his hands. It is the first evidence of a Late Bronze Age cemetery (1200-800 BC). And for Krohn the first indication of an archaeological gold mine. https://www.landeszeitung.de/lueneburg/51009-zurueck-in-die-fruehe-bronzezeit-neue-schautafel-am-kronsberg/

The origins of today's Scharnebecker Mühle are closely linked to the former monastery there. In 1253, a Cistercian monastery was built not far from today's mill, which soon became one of the most influential in northern Germany. Among other things, the monks built a water mill on the site of today's Scharnebecker mill. To them To operate, they used the slope of the Sauerbach and dammed it in today's monastery ponds and the mill pond. Permanent operation of the mill was only possible with the help of these ponds. The ponds were also used for fish farming and still exist today. There are still fish there too. There is even the clubhouse of the Scharnebeck fishing club on the mill pond. However, due to the water shortage in the Sauerbach, it was necessary to install a steam engine as early as 1900, which was replaced by an electric motor in 1942. In 1946 the miller finally filled in the water channel. The mill is still in use today and is used for the production of special horse and poultry mueslis, which are delivered worldwide. https://www.scharnebeck.de/home/kultur-tourismus/freizeit-kultur/sehenswuerdigungen-pur/scharnebecker-muehle.aspx

The mill ponds near Scharnebeck are several small ponds on the southern edge of Scharnebeck, surrounded by healthy trees, which always provide a shady spot, especially in summer. There are a total of three ponds, which are referred to as Pond A, Pond B and Pond C. The club house is also located at Mühlenteich A. The mill ponds belong to a pond that is located in the southeast of the municipality of Scharnebeck in the district of Lüneburg in Lower Saxony. The pond is located southwest of the Scharnebeck cemetery, in the Kronsberg district. The ponds are fed by the Sauerbach, which flows into the pond system from the north into the northernmost pond, exits there in the southeast and flows in a larger curve to the left into the southernmost pond of the pond system. From the “main street” in the north of the pond, the “Auf der Domain” road going east from there and the “Mühlenstraße” going south-east lead directly to the north-western bank of the northernmost pond in the pond. The "Tiergartenweg" branching off to the south from this street leads past the western banks of the other ponds in the pond. The path that branches off from "Mühlenstraße" leads to the east bank of the other ponds in the pond complex, in addition to the western bank of the northernmost pond. The mill ponds are surrounded on all banks by a narrow or wider strip of trees. The main fish species in the mill ponds near Scharnebeck include eels, tench, pike, perch, carp and various types of white fish. https://www.fisch-hitparade.de/gewaesser/muehlenteiche-scharnebeck

The stately half-timbered building of this mill is located on the Neetze between the forest areas of the Fuhrenkamp and the Buchholzheide. It is first mentioned in the document book of the Scharnebeck monastery, which reports on a trade in 1330, through which the mill belonging to the Lüne monastery fell to the Scharnebeck monastery in exchange for a farm in Eyendorf.
